Subject: Cleaning Crew Access — Tonight

Hi Night Shift,

The cleaning crew from Marwick & Dale will be on site tonight between 22:00 and 02:00, covering Levels 1 and 3 of Fenholt Tower. Please let them through the service entrance as usual. If the intercom is unattended, they can let themselves in using the door code below.

door code, yagap-bahof: bdg-O-05

INC-2291: Fleet fuel-usage report failing on the Drayhollow prod worker since last night's deploy. Root cause: env file was copied from staging, so FUEL_DB_HOST points at the Kestwick test replica and the report aggregates zero rows. Fix: set FUEL_DB_HOST=drayhollow-prod-3 and FUEL_REPORT_TZ=UTC, then rerun the 02:00 job manually. The prod telemetry API also rejects the staging credential. After the host and timezone lines, append the line that sets the telemetry secret.

env line for bagug-bagap: COURIER_KEY3=920

## Soft Deletes on the Orders Table

Welcome aboard! One quirk you'll hit early at Brindlecart: we never hard-delete rows from `orders`. Instead, a `deleted_at` timestamp gets set, and every query in the app layer filters on it being null. If a customer "disappears" an order, it's still there — check before panicking. The weekly Mossfen sweep archives anything soft-deleted for over a year. To poke around the orders schema in the sandbox environment, connect with the string below.

replica DSN, kajep-yahag: mssql://praok_svc:iF@db-8d68.plorvaio.local:5432/eliion